Founded by Bart Cochran and Chad Hansen LEAP Charities (Love, Empowerment, And Partnership) mission is to develop and preserve affordable housing while providing empowering services that lead to greater housing stability. LEAP Housing is a Boise-based nonprofit who believes all people deserve an opportunity to access a safe, stable and affordable home. They accomplish their mission in five ways; operation of a temporary housing program as a soft landing, connection of renters to home buying resources, research on affordable housing trends and solutions, development and management of affordable housing, and preservation of existing affordable housing. LEAP’s vision is to transform communities with hope, connection, and secure housing. 

LEAP is working day in and day out to help families of all backgrounds to find security in their housing needs. Be it providing clean, safe and affordable welcome housing for some of our world’s most marginalized people; developing attractive and affordable housing for some of our community’s most impoverished at 30% or below of the median income; preserving existing manufactured housing in the face of development; or assisting folks who think homeownership is out of their reach.

Lastly, construction is underway on their Taft Street Project! This will be two single family rental homes on land owned by the Collister United Methodist Church. LEAP is excited for construction to begin. Slowly but surely getting that much closer to providing two stable housing opportunities for the Valley!
